Workforce Development

 

In today’s competitive labor market, organizations must look to new ways to develop the pool of workers they will need to stay ahead of their competition. Workforce development techniques need to be applied to skill-shortage positions before the lack of qualified workers causes your business to loose market share, or worse, be forced to drop a specific line of business altogether.

IHRS has innovative methods to “grow-your-own” workforce that involve a joint commitment by the potential pool of workers and from the organization. Whether you work with your local community college or university or you bring the training in-house, instruction and hands-on training usually occurs during the employee’s normal working hours and replaces the worker’s ability to earn his normal income. Creative scheduling and subsidies can address these issues, and binding contracts with the employee can ensure the organization gets a return on its investment.

If your organization is looking at your workforce needs two, three, or five years out, creative and innovative workforce development techniques should be considered. Establishing a workforce development plan is a win for your organization and a win for your existing employees looking for an opportunity to improve themselves and increase their earning potential.
